MAX3232CSE belongs to the category of integrated circuits (ICs).
The MAX3232CSE is commonly used as a dual RS-232 driver/receiver. It is designed to convert TTL/CMOS logic levels to RS-232 voltage levels and vice versa.
The MAX3232CSE comes in a small outline package (SOIC) with 16 pins.
The essence of the MAX3232CSE lies in its ability to provide reliable and efficient conversion between TTL/CMOS logic levels and RS-232 voltage levels.
The MAX3232CSE is typically packaged in reels or tubes, with quantities varying depending on the supplier.
The MAX3232CSE operates by converting TTL/CMOS logic levels to RS-232 voltage levels using an internal charge pump. It utilizes a dual driver/receiver configuration to enable bidirectional communication between TTL/CMOS devices and RS-232 interfaces. The device also incorporates ESD protection to safeguard the RS-232 I/O pins.
The MAX3232CSE finds applications in various fields, including: 1. Industrial automation 2. Telecommunications 3. Networking equipment 4. Embedded systems 5. Consumer electronics

Q: What is MAX3232CSE? A: MAX3232CSE is a popular RS-232 transceiver IC that converts TTL/CMOS logic levels to RS-232 voltage levels.
Q: What is the operating voltage range of MAX3232CSE? A: The operating voltage range of MAX3232CSE is typically between 3.0V and 5.5V.
Q: Can I use MAX3232CSE for bidirectional communication? A: Yes, MAX3232CSE supports bidirectional communication by providing separate transmit and receive channels.
Q: How many data lines can be connected to MAX3232CSE? A: MAX3232CSE supports up to two data lines, one for transmitting and one for receiving data.
Q: What is the maximum data rate supported by MAX3232CSE? A: MAX3232CSE can support data rates up to 250 kbps.
Q: Can I connect MAX3232CSE directly to a microcontroller? A: Yes, MAX3232CSE can be directly connected to a microcontroller's UART pins.
Q: Does MAX3232CSE require external capacitors? A: Yes, MAX3232CSE requires four external capacitors for proper operation.
Q: Can I use MAX3232CSE with both 3.3V and 5V systems? A: Yes, MAX3232CSE is compatible with both 3.3V and 5V systems.
Q: Is MAX3232CSE suitable for long-distance communication? A: No, MAX3232CSE is designed for short-distance communication within a few meters.
Q: Can I use MAX3232CSE in industrial applications? A: Yes, MAX3232CSE is commonly used in industrial applications that require RS-232 communication.
